Details A new hemiterpene glycoside (1) was isolated from ripe tomatoes (the fruit of Lycopersicon esculentum, Solanaceae) along with eight known compounds. The chemical structure of 1 was determined to be 2-methylbutan-1-ol β-d-glucopyranosyl-(1 → 6)-β-d-glucopyranoside, based on spectroscopic data as well as chemical evidence. In addition, the radical-scavenging activities of the isolated compounds on the free radical of 1,1-diphenyl-2-picrylhydrazyl were examined. Among the tested compounds, tryptophan, 4-O-β-d-glucopyranosyl caffeic acid and dihydro-p-coumaryl alcohol γ-O-β-d-glucopyranoside demonstrated 42.0%, 50.1% and 76.0% scavenging activities, respectively, at a concentration of 0.5 mM.
